T. S. Eliot

Thomas Stearns Eliot OM (born September 26, 1888 in St. Louis, Missouri) was a poet, writer, and playwright who was best known for being considered one of the 20th century’s major poets and for his work on the 1925 poem, “The Hollow Men.” T. S. died on January 4, 1965 and his death was because emphysema. He died at age 76.
